Abstract: The Hard Real-Time Ethernet Switch (HaRTES) allows using the same network to handle multiple traffic flows, without compromising the performance of real-time applications. Furthermore, it also provides flexible and on-line scheduling techniques with admission control capabilities, thus real-time communications flows can be added, removed and updated online with strict temporal isolation. However, HaRTES lacked a standard management interface to configure its parameters and view its status. This paper describes a multiprotocol (SNMP and NETCONF) management interface design, and implementation. It also presents a preliminary validation of the two management technologies.
